Buses:
You’re in luck, as there’s a wealth of bus services running in and around Windermere. Just a stone’s throw away from our property, you’ll find bus stops that’ll connect you to the best of the Lake District.
Bus Route 555, for instance, offers a scenic ride between Lancaster and Keswick, passing through Windermere, Ambleside, Grasmere, and more. For trips towards Bowness, Kendal, or Newby Bridge, check out Bus Routes 6, 6X, and 599. And don’t forget Route 599, it’s an open-top service during the summer – perfect for soaking up those breath taking views!
Trains:
If you’re venturing further afield, Windermere train station is just a 5-minute taxi ride away (or 20 mins walk). With regular services to Oxenholme Lake District station, it conveniently links you with the West Coast mainline. This means you’re directly connected to major UK cities like London, Glasgow, Manchester, and Birmingham – making your journeys a breeze!
